• Manage and interpret supplier/subcontractor schedules and assess impacts on program schedules and milestones • Manage integrated master schedules, schedule risks, and opportunities • Develop and manage the SMT RAIL/action-item tracker for supplier, subcontractor, and internal actions • Manage supplier performance, open orders, delivery, and dock dates • Define and develop material strategies for on-time delivery • Plan, define, establish, communicate, monitor, and control subcontractor scope • Analyze changes across technical, cost, schedule, and quality requirements and develop alternatives • Develop NGMS Statements of Work through collaboration with technical and programmatic stakeholders • Adhere to subcontract scope and manage changes through control board activities • Identify, assess, manage, and communicate subcontract risks and opportunities throughout the lifecycle • Assist the Program and Supplier Management Team Lead with technical content for RFIs, RFPs, and related requests • Review and approve technical subcontractor deliverables with cross-functional SME guidance • Prepare executive-level briefings and develop project-monitoring, intervention, and problem-solving mechanisms • Develop and review Supplier Statements of Work • Support supplier proposal responses, technical evaluations, Basis of Estimates reviews, proposal quality reviews, and proposal-related reviews
• Bachelor's degree with a minimum of 8 years of experience in supply chain, program management, business management or related; Master's degree with a minimum of 6 years of experience in these areas; or an additional 4 years of related experience in lieu of a Bachelor's degree • At least 3 years of experience supporting U.S. Government contracts and/or large supplier management portfolio experience in other industries • At least 3 years of financial experience in EVMS or similar cost and schedule management systems • At least 2 years of experience managing a Program effort or Major Subcontract in a supply chain, SMT, or program/project management role • Must be a US Citizen • Preferred: strategic direction experience regarding Program Management or Supply Chain products, processes, applications, and technology • Preferred: Supplier Management experience on a program in U.S. Government contracts • Preferred: experience with technical evaluations of supplier proposals and subsequent contract negotiations • Preferred: experience managing technical risks and opportunities • Preferred: experience in Earned Value Management (EVM) or as a control account manager (CAM)
